Ilima Price Analysis

The current market price for Ilima from SM Base Set is $0.09 as of 2026. Recent sales range from a low of $0.09 to a high of $0.09. A PSA 10 (Gem Mint) graded copy is valued at $100.00 — approximately 1111.1x the ungraded market price. PSA 9 (Mint) copies sell for around $31.00. This card sees moderate trading activity, with 175 recorded sales providing reliable pricing data.

Grading Ilima

Professional grading is available for Ilima and can significantly impact its market value. Graded versions tracked include: PSA 10, PSA 9. Ungraded pricing is tracked across conditions: LIGHTLY PLAYED, NEAR MINT, DAMAGED, MODERATELY PLAYED. At this price point, grading is generally not cost-effective as the grading fee may exceed the card's ungraded value. Consider grading only for sentimental or personal collection purposes.
